It's possible to send faxes with ADSL ONLY if you use a standard, analog fax
modem connected to the DSL line through a line filter (supplied by your DSL
provider so you can connect an ordinary telephone to the DSL line). XP Fax
only knows how to use an analog modem, no fax machines or fax services, with
exception of the Shared Fax Service provided by either Microsoft Small
Business Server or Windows Server 2003. Internet Fax services are another
option which don't require either a modem or telephone line. More info on
these services is here:
